18 Jul 2025 |
emily | so that it's irrelevant by the time it happens | 17:13:34 |
Charles | In reply to @f0x:pixie.town couldn't you always just redact/sorta ignore a tombstone event? Hmm I don't think redactions will render a tombstone ineffectual, it will only redact semantically ignorable fields | 17:16:35 |
Charles | In reply to @emilazy:matrix.org ...so this means that after all that talk about whether Matrix's sacrifices to have rooms not controlled by one homeserver are worth it, now rooms are going to be controlled by one nameserver Bingo | 17:16:52 |
[0x4A6F] | Yeah, we might just create new rooms with the admin (Moderation Team) account and migrate from tombstone rooms, when draupnir supports that new room version. | 17:16:51 |
Cat | Draupnir will most likely support it in time. | 17:19:25 |
f0x | ah right, so you'd have to really mess with the room state to override it (and that's still ineffectual for everyone that's already followed the upgrade) | 17:19:42 |
Cat | We got a 3 week extension and Gnuxie is gone for 2 of them on vaccation but even before the vaccation prelim v12 support was added. | 17:19:44 |
emily | In reply to @f0x:pixie.town ah right, so you'd have to really mess with the room state to override it (and that's still ineffectual for everyone that's already followed the upgrade) yeah my fear is people not thinking about their absentee founder as a threat at all and then disaster. but tbf I guess you have to proactively defend against that to some extent in current Matrix too | 17:20:32 |
Charles | In reply to @cat:feline.support Even tho they are being silly attempting to fuck with room upgrades even more due to that the new room ID format will break the Synapse chicken and Egg dance of creating the room ID for the next itteration of the room before the create event it self so that the create event can refer to the tombstone that points to the new room. Yeah IMO they need to drop this change, many good reasons to keep it, no good reasons to drop it | 17:20:41 |
Cat | And as long as Gnuxie signs off on it i can merge changes into the project and i think cut releases even (I have the right to github wise i just dont know the pipeline) so like Draupnir is in good hands. | 17:20:44 |
emily | In reply to @charles:computer.surgery Bingo I think this chat protocol could be improved somewhat. | 17:21:03 |
Charles | I personally am interested in other protocols at this point | 17:21:28 |
emily | In reply to @charles:computer.surgery Yeah IMO they need to drop this change, many good reasons to keep it, no good reasons to drop it I don't know if the embargo lifted yet and I assume you're on the inside of it so feel free to decline to comment but: in your judgement should NixOS even bother trying to upgrade our rooms? or just wait until a less rushed v13 or something? | 17:22:03 |
Charles | I think I can reasonably confirm I have insider info but on the second point I think I'll just ask if you saw the update to the blog post | 17:23:15 |
emily | I did, yeah. I was hoping for more nuance 😅 | 17:23:36 |
emily | but I guess all relevant nuance is an embargo violation really | 17:23:50 |
f0x | given nixos was already targeted heavily by the spam attacks, I would be afraid of that same person/group trying to mess with rooms, but probably only when the vuln/poc is actually public | 17:23:52 |
Charles | That is worth considering for sure | 17:24:20 |
emily | I don't think we even have a way to upgrade our hundreds of rooms en masse | 17:24:38 |
emily | We've just been manually doing it when the split brain gets bad enough | 17:24:44 |
emily | and from @k900:0upti.me's grumbling I get the impression it's been very manual every time | 17:25:10 |
f0x | ideally Draupnir/*nir could handle it, though not sure if they consider that out of scope | 17:25:27 |
emily | if we should be thinking about upgrading in a fairly timely manner after disclosure then that's only an option if they ship it quick I guess | 17:26:47 |
f0x | might need to figure out and automated way for my irc bridge's rooms too, but I don't think the bridge itself even handles room upgrades properly.... ugh | 17:27:09 |
f0x | * might need to figure out an automated way for my irc bridge's rooms too, but I don't think the bridge itself even handles room upgrades properly.... ugh | 17:27:41 |
Charles | Yeah bridges are like the number one reason people don't upgrade rooms | 17:27:47 |
Cat | Im not on the inside of the embargo in any capacity so i have no handcuffs. And dont wait for v13 thats way too far off in the pipeline. | 17:27:55 |
Cat | Its not out of scope. | 17:28:31 |
Cat | Especially after the blogpost im writing. | 17:28:38 |
f0x | oh that's good to hear :) | 17:29:19 |